High alert security for VIPs in Islamabad
LAHORE:
After the killing of Abdullah Mahsud, the law-enforcing agencies have
been directed to high alert in Islamabad.
The interior ministry of Punjab had issued a warning
a few days before that seven suicide bombers of Baitullah Mahsud Group
had entered Islamabad.
In a circular issued by Secretary Interior Ministry
Punjab Khusro Pervez to high police officials and heads of other law-enforcing
agencies, it was said that seven suicide bombers of Baitullah Mahsud
Group entered Islamabad to target the government officials and important
installations. These persons already lived in Islamabad and know about
all the important buildings and offices of the city.
It was directed in the circular that considering the
recent suicide attacks in various areas of the country, all strict
security measures must be adopted in Islamabad.
According to the sources, due to any possible reaction
after the killing of Abdullah Mahsud security high alerted for the
important personalities and offices in Punjab.
